Feature-by-feature comparison specsheet
MetricFreeCADFusion 360
Expert score★ 4.2/5★ 4.8/5
PricingFree$85 (Subscription)
PlatformsWindows, macOS, LinuxWindows, macOS, Android, iOS
External reviews475 reviews on G2 / Capterra / TrustRadius / Software Advice / GetApp4,203 reviews on G2 / Capterra / TrustRadius / Gartner Peer Insights / Software Advice / GetApp / Trustpilot
Free trialAlways free30 days
File formatsFCStd, STEP, IGES, BREP, OBJ, STL, …F3D, STEP, IGES, SAT, STL, DWG, …
DeploymentDesktopDesktop, Cloud, Web, Mobile
API / SDKYes (Python API)Yes (Fusion API)
IndustriesHobbyist, Education, EngineeringIndustrial Design, Electronics, Prototyping
StrengthsCompletely free · Python scriptable · Excellent cross-platformSeamless cloud sync · Exceptional CAM value · Native Apple Silicon
LimitationsCluttered UI · Stability issues · Steep learning curveCloud dependency · Subscription only · Learning curve
